This study aims to analyze land suitability for mangrove ecosystem rehabilitation in Minangatoa Hamlet, Soppeng Riaja District, Barru Regency. The background of this study is based on the important role of mangrove ecosystems as coastal protection, coastal ecosystem buffers, habitats for various biota, and supports the lives of coastal communities. However, mangrove damage due to human activities and natural factors has resulted in a reduction in the ecological and economic functions of the area. Therefore, a land suitability study is needed as a basis for appropriate rehabilitation planning. The research method used includes field surveys to collect data on environmental parameters such as soil texture, salinity, soil pH, mangrove density, inundation depth, and tidal range. The data were then analyzed using the mangrove land suitability classification guidelines from the Ministry of Environment and Forestry, with grouping into very suitable, suitable, conditionally suitable, and unsuitable classes. The results of the study of coastal morphology (substrate and slope) in Minangatoa Hamlet are suitable for mangrove rehabilitation, while the physical parameters of oceanography (currents, tides, salinity, temperature, waves) in Minangatoa Hamlet are categorized as suitable for mangrove rehabilitation.
